Bert Freudenberg uploaded a new version of Etoys to project Etoys: http://source.squeak.org/etoys/Etoys-bf.3.mcz
==================== Summary ====================
Name: Etoys-bf.3 Author: bf Time: 3 May 2010, 12:00:49 pm UUID: 07d78cbc-14c0-42f1-9ff7-f2b62d065d43 Ancestors: Etoys-bf.2
- remove unused EToySystem class
=============== Diff against Etoys-bf.2 ===============
Item was removed: - ----- Method: EToySystem classSide>>cleanupsForRelease (in category 'development support') ----- - cleanupsForRelease - "Miscellaneous space cleanups to do before a release." - "EToySystem cleanupsForRelease" - - Socket deadServer: ''. "Don't reveal any specific server name" - HandMorph initialize. "free cached ColorChart" - PaintBoxMorph initialize. "forces Prototype to let go of extra things it might hold" - Smalltalk removeKey: #AA ifAbsent: []. - Smalltalk removeKey: #BB ifAbsent: []. - Smalltalk removeKey: #CC ifAbsent: []. - Smalltalk removeKey: #DD ifAbsent: []. - Smalltalk removeKey: #Temp ifAbsent: []. - - ScriptingSystem reclaimSpace. - Smalltalk cleanOutUndeclared. - Smalltalk reclaimDependents. - Smalltalk forgetDoIts. - Smalltalk removeEmptyMessageCategories. - Symbol rehash. - !
Item was removed: - ----- Method: EToySystem classSide>>fixComicCharacters (in category 'misc') ----- - fixComicCharacters - "EToySystem fixComicCharacters" - ((TextConstants at: #ComicBold) fontAt: 3) characterFormAt: $_ put: - (Form - extent: 9@16 - depth: 1 - fromArray: #( 0 0 0 134217728 402653184 805306368 2139095040 4278190080 2139095040 805306368 402653184 134217728 0 0 0 0) - offset: 0@0). - - ((TextConstants at: #ComicBold) fontAt: 3) characterFormAt: $1 put: - (Form - extent: 5@16 - depth: 1 - fromArray: #( 0 0 0 0 1610612736 3758096384 3758096384 1610612736 1610612736 1610612736 1610612736 4026531840 4026531840 0 0 0) - offset: 0@0). - - - ((TextConstants at: #ComicBold) fontAt: 3) characterFormAt: $2 put: - (Form - extent: 6@16 - depth: 1 - fromArray: #( 0 0 0 0 1879048192 4160749568 2550136832 939524096 1879048192 3758096384 3221225472 4160749568 4160749568 0 0 0) - offset: 0@0). - - - ((TextConstants at: #ComicBold) fontAt: 3) characterFormAt: $4 put: - (Form - extent: 7@16 - depth: 1 - fromArray: #( 0 0 0 0 134217728 402653184 402653184 939524096 1476395008 4227858432 4227858432 402653184 402653184 0 0 0) - offset: 0@0). - - ((TextConstants at: #ComicBold) fontAt: 3) characterFormAt: $j put: - (Form - extent: 4@16 - depth: 1 - fromArray: #( 0 0 0 0 1610612736 1610612736 0 1610612736 1610612736 1610612736 1610612736 1610612736 1610612736 1610612736 3758096384 3221225472) - offset: 0@0). - - !
Item was removed: - StandardScriptingSystem subclass: #EToySystem - instanceVariableNames: '' - classVariableNames: 'EToyVersion EToyVersionDate' - poolDictionaries: '' - category: 'Etoys-Experimental'! - - !EToySystem commentStamp: '<historical>' prior: 0! - A global object holding onto properties and code of the overall E-toy system of the moment. Its code is entirely held on the class side; the class is never instantiated.!
Item was removed: - ----- Method: EToySystem classSide>>loadJanForms (in category 'development support') ----- - loadJanForms - "EToySystem loadJanForms" - - | aReferenceStream newFormDict | - aReferenceStream _ ReferenceStream fileNamed: 'JanForms'. - newFormDict _ aReferenceStream next. - aReferenceStream close. - newFormDict associationsDo: - [:assoc | Imports default importImage: assoc value named: assoc key]!
Item was removed: - ----- Method: EToySystem classSide>>prepareRelease (in category 'stripped') ----- - prepareRelease - self codeStrippedOut: '2.3External'!
Item was removed: - ----- Method: EToySystem classSide>>stripMethodsForExternalRelease (in category 'development support') ----- - stripMethodsForExternalRelease - "EToySystem stripMethodsForExternalRelease" - - SmalltalkImage current stripMethods: self methodsToStripForExternalRelease messageCode: '2.3External'!
Item was removed: - ----- Method: EToySystem classSide>>previewEToysOn: (in category 'stripped') ----- - previewEToysOn: arg1 - self codeStrippedOut: '2.3External'!
Item was removed: - ----- Method: EToySystem classSide>>methodsToStripForExternalRelease (in category 'external release') ----- - methodsToStripForExternalRelease - "Answer a list of triplets #(className, class/instance, methodName) of methods to be stripped in an external release." - ^ #( - (EToySystem class prepareRelease) - (EToySystem class previewEToysOn:) - )!
etoys-dev@lists.squeakfoundation.org